JSON 是一种用于存储和交换数据的轻量级数据格式,在现代编程中被广泛应用。当我们需要从 JSON 数据中提取特定信息时,使用 JSON 路径是一种十分有效的方法。
JSON 路径是一种类似于 XPath 的查询语言,它允许我们根据特定的规则来定位和提取 JSON 数据中的元素。通过使用 JSON 路径,我们可以快速准确地定位到需要的数据,提高数据处理的效率。
那么,如何使用 JSON 路径呢?首先,我们需要了解 JSON 路径的基本语法和规则。JSON 路径由一系列路径表达式组成,路径表达式使用特定的语法来描述要提取的数据位置。例如,”$ .store.book[0].title” 表示我们要提取 JSON 数据中 store 对象下的第一本书的标题信息。
接下来,我们需要选择一个合适的 JSON 路径解析器来解析我们编写的 JSON 路径。常用的 JSON 路径解析器有 JsonPath、Jayway JsonPath 等,它们都提供了丰富的功能和易于使用的 API,让我们可以方便地执行 JSON 路径查询操作。
最后,我们可以将 JSON 路径和 JSON 数据传递给 JSON 路径解析器,然后执行查询操作,即可获得我们想要的数据。通过这种方式,我们可以轻松地从复杂的 JSON 数据中提取出我们需要的信息,实现数据的快速获取和处理。
总的来说,使用 JSON 路径是一种十分便捷和有效的方法,它可以帮助我们快速定位和提取 JSON 数据中的元素,提高数据处理的效率。希望通过本文的介绍,您能对如何使用 JSON 路径有一个更好的理解和掌握。【参考:https://bump.sh/blog/how-to-use-json-path】。
了解更多有趣的事情:https://blog.ds3783.com/